Haddiscoe to Cricklewood by train

A train trip from Haddiscoe to Cricklewood takes about 4hrs 2 mins on average, covering roughly 102 miles (165 kilometres). With around 14 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£13.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Haddiscoe to Cricklewood start from as little as £13.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Haddiscoe to Cricklewood start from £75.10 one way, or £76.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Haddiscoe to Cricklewood are available for £109.10 one way, or £160.20 return

Everything you need to know about Haddiscoe Station

Welcome to Haddiscoe Train Station: Your Gateway to Suffolk and Beyond

Nestled in the picturesque rural countryside of Norfolk, Haddiscoe train station is a charming little hub that may not offer all the bells and whistles of a major city terminal, but provides a quaint entry point to explore some of England's more serene landscapes. Whether you’re in for a short countryside break or setting off on a longer journey to bustling metropolitans, Haddiscoe offers a peaceful starting point.

Station Facilities and Services

Upon arriving at Haddiscoe station, you’ll find the practical necessities for your trip. While it lacks a traditional ticket office, the presence of ticket machines ensures you won't miss out on getting your tickets sorted. These machines are also accessible to passengers with disabilities, furthering the station’s commitment to inclusivity. Although there are no smartcard services, you can easily collect tickets purchased online.

Despite its rural setting, Haddiscoe station is equipped with essential customer facilities such as information screens for real-time train departures and help points for any immediate assistance required. Although the station might be small, it spares no effort in ensuring passenger safety and ease of travel with the inclusion of a CCTV system.

Accessibility and Parking

Haddiscoe offers step-free access, making it convenient for those with mobility challenges. It's worth noting that platform 2, for trains towards Lowestoft, is only accessible via a barrow crossing, which might require assistance. For those driving in, parking is hassle-free with spaces operated by National Car Parks Ltd, and it remains open 24 hours with minimal fees.

Connectivity and Commuting

Being tucked away doesn’t mean Haddiscoe is disconnected. Though there’s no direct local bus service, rail replacement services use the station car park, ensuring you’re still mobile during maintenance or disruptions. However, only mini-buses can serve due to access limitations. The countryside around bears witness to mesmerising scenery and quaint towns like Reedham and Oulton Broad North, which are a short train journey away.

Everything you need to know about Cricklewood Station

Welcome to Cricklewood Station: A Journey Begins Here

Nestled within the bustling London Borough of Barnet, Cricklewood Station is a gateway to both local and long-distance travel for thousands of passengers daily. With its convenient position and reliable services, this station is your starting point for numerous adventures, whether you're commuting into the heart of London or planning a weekend escape beyond the city limits.

Facilities and Amenities at Cricklewood Station

Cricklewood Station boasts a variety of facilities to ensure a comfortable journey. The ticket office is open Monday to Friday from 6:10 AM to 7:10 PM, Saturday from 8:40 AM to 4:45 PM, and on Sunday from 9:15 AM to 5:45 PM. Ticket machines are available 24/7, allowing for online ticket collection and assistance for those with a Disabled Persons Railcard.

Though the station lacks a waiting room or lounge, it does offer seating areas for its passengers. CCTV cameras are strategically placed to ensure safety, while customer help points are always accessible. A key highlight is the station's commitment to accessibility, offering step-free access to platform 1 and well-designed ticket machines for ease of use. Staff assistance is available throughout operating hours, ensuring a seamless travel experience.

Onward Transport Options at Cricklewood

The station acts as a significant hub connecting you to various transport options. Local bus services are easily accessible from the station, providing a seamless continuation of your journey throughout the Greater London area. Should you require a rail replacement service, precise location details are always available to facilitate your travel plans.

Popular Destinations from Cricklewood Station

From vibrant city centers to historic landmarks, the train services from Cricklewood unlock a world of possibilities. Frequent services to London St Pancras International, Farringdon, and Kentish Town keep you well-connected to central London’s key locations. Additionally, traveling to quaint suburban locales like Elstree and Borehamwood or West Hampstead Thameslink is convenient and swift.

For those seeking a city escape, frequent trains to St Albans City and direct connections to major airports like Luton Airport Parkway and Gatwick Airport make this station a strategic choice for both business and leisure travelers alike.
